Abstract

The invention provides a method for forming a conducting wire on an insulated heat-conducting metal substrate in a vacuum sputtering way, which comprises the following steps: firstly, the insulated heat-conducting metal substrate is provided; secondly, the metal substrate is arranged in a plasma reaction chamber and gas mixture mixed with high subversive gas is led into the plasma reaction chamber, and the surface of the metal substrate is irregularly corroded to form nanometer surface roughness; thirdly, plasma chemical vapor disposition is performed in the plasma reaction chamber to produce radical plasmas, and laminated high heat-conducting coating is form on the surface of the metal substrate; fourthly, high heat-conducting insulating glue is coated; fifthly, the outer layer of the metal substrate on which the laminated high heat-conducting coating is formed is sputtered with a metal conducting layer and a metal protecting layer; sixthly, a conductor part of an etch-resisting film shielding circuit diagram is etched to remove a nonconductor part and then an etch-resisting film is removed; seventhly, liquid photosensitive welding-resisting ink is printed. The invention has simple process, best heat conduction and more environmental-friendly process.

[technical field]
The present invention is a kind of method that forms the conducting wire on insulated substrate, particularly adopts vacuum splashing and plating technology to form the method for conducting wire on insulated heat-conducting metal substrate.
[background technology]
Tradition insulating heat-conductive substrate, as FR4 printed circuit board (PCB) (PCB), thermal conductivity (K) is about 0.36W/mK, its shortcoming is that hot property is relatively poor, and the conducting wire preparation method is for spraying conductive paint, electroless copper in regular turn, etching the printed foil circuit again on traditional insulating heat-conductive substrate on plastic base, and wherein the shortcoming of electroless copper is to relate to environmental problem such as waste water treatment in the processing procedure.
Have not yet to see and on insulated heat-conducting metal substrate, directly adopt the vacuum splashing and plating mode to make the method for conducting wire.
[summary of the invention]
The object of the invention is to provide the method for vacuum splashing and plating formation conducting wire on a kind of insulated heat-conducting metal substrate, and making technology is simple, less contaminated environment.
For reaching above-mentioned purpose, vacuum splashing and plating forms the method for conducting wire on a kind of insulated heat-conducting metal substrate provided by the invention, and may further comprise the steps: (1) provides an insulated heat-conducting metal substrate; (2) this substrate is inserted in the plasma reaction chamber and feed the admixture of gas that is mixed with highly aggressive gas, scrambling ground is done on the surface of this metal base corroded to form the nanoscale surface roughness; (3), produce the free radical plasma, and form laminated high heat-conducting coating on the surface of this metal base with this plasma reaction chamber ionic medium chemical vapour deposition (CVD); (4) coating one deck high heat conductive insulating glue; (5) metal conducting layer and metal protection layer on the outer sputter of the metal base of laminated high heat-conducting coating; (6) conductor part of etch-resisting film screened circuit figure, the non-conductor part is removed in etching, sloughs etch-resisting film again; (7) printing liquid photosensitive welding resistant printing ink.
Compared with prior art, the present invention adopts the combination of vacuum splashing and plating and etching technique to form the conducting wire, and manufacturing process is simple, and thermal conductivity is good, and relatively environmental protection of technology.

[embodiment]
The method of vacuum splashing and plating formation conducting wire is as follows on the insulated heat-conducting metal substrate of the present invention:
1, provides a metal base, this base material can be copper alloy, stainless steel, Ni-Ti alloy, magnesium alloy or aluminium alloy, and the surface of this metal base is strip, plane, curved surface or 3D shape, and this base material carried out pre-treatment, specifically comprise steps such as degreasing, pickling, cleaning, make its cleaning surfaces, and this metal base is placed plasma reaction chamber, at this moment, metallic substrate surface can be with 20~30 volts negative voltage.
Above-mentioned plasma reaction chamber can be batch or continous way (in-line) chemical vapor deposition reaction chamber.
2, plasma pre-treatment, the admixture of gas that is mixed with highly aggressive gas is fed in this plasma reaction chamber, scrambling is done on the surface of this metal base corroded, wherein, comprise also in this admixture of gas that reactant gas (can be O to form the nanoscale surface roughness 2Or N 2) or inert gas (can be Ar or He).
Above-mentioned highly aggressive gas can be CF 4, CF 2Cl 2Or Cl 2One or more.
3, plasma gas-phase deposit, this metal base carries out PCVD in this plasma reaction chamber, so that its surface forms laminated high heat-conducting coating, wherein, this high heat conducting coating formed with plasma interface conversion layer and plasma high heat conductive insulating stacking adding, and plasma gas-phase deposit specifically comprises following two fine division step: plasma gas-phase deposit graded bedding and plasma gas-phase deposit high heat conductive insulating layer.
Plasma gas-phase deposit graded bedding: will be mixed with silicon source predecessor (Precursor, as TMS) admixture of gas feed in this plasma reaction chamber, produce the first free radical plasma by this admixture of gas of plasma activation in plasma reaction chamber, the first free radical plasma produces plasma interface conversion layer (for example silicon dioxide) against the surface that low-pressure vapor phase is diffused in this metal base.The plasma interface conversion layer can be the hydrophobic or hydrophilic characteristic surface who converts may command and homogeneous in metal surface, and can reduce surface roughness by big spoke.The thickness of this plasma interface conversion layer is from about 10 nanometers to 10 micron, and the structure of this plasma interface conversion layer can be monofilm or multilayer film, can change at any time that the gas phase composition is formed and the superposition or the gradual change that form plasma deposition of different nature interface conversion layer.
More than, also comprise reactant gas in the admixture of gas, and reactant gas comprises oxygen or steam.
Plasma gas-phase deposit high heat conductive insulating layer: the admixture of gas that will be mixed with high heat conduction chemistry precursors feeds in this plasma reaction chamber, in plasma reaction chamber, produce the second free radical plasma by this admixture of gas of plasma activation, the second free radical plasma produces plasma high heat conductive insulating layer against the surface that low-pressure vapor phase is diffused in this plasma interface conversion layer, wherein, the high heat conductive insulating layer that is produced can be AlN, BeO or Ta 2O 5The high heat conductive insulating layer thickness is from about 20 nanometers to 10 micron.
The high heat conduction chemistry precursors that includes metal or pottery in the above-mentioned gas mixture is (as the precursors Ta (EtCp) of Ta 2(CO) H EtCp or Al (CH 3) 3), reactant gas is (as O 2, N 2, H 2O or NH 3) and inert gas (as Ar or He).
4, coating one layer thickness is the high heat conductive insulating glue of 5~25 μ m, this high heat conductive insulating glue can be one of ultraviolet hardening, heat curing-type or ultraviolet hardening mixing heat curing-type, and its pyroconductivity>2~3W/ (mK), cracking temperature>200 ℃, thermal resistance Buddhist nun is between 0.3~0.7W/ (mK), and coating can be adopted rotary coating (Spin) or dip-coating (Dip) or printing (Print) mode.
More than, the high-heat-conductivity glue insulation is to make by adding high conduction material in the insulating cement.
5, in generation metal conducting layer and metal protection layer on the outer sputter of metal base of aluminium nitride film arranged, wherein, the step of jet-plating metallization conductive layer and metal protection layer is as follows:
The concrete steps of jet-plating metallization conductive layer: have the metal base of aluminium nitride film to insert in the vacuum chamber generation, be evacuated to 10 -5Behind the torr, feed argon gas and maintain 1~3 * 10 -3Torr, start the substrate back bias voltage-300~-600Volt, start sputter copper target this moment, the current density of control sputtered target material is at 0.1~1W/cm 2, carry out copper facing, about 0.5~5 μ m of copper film THICKNESS CONTROL;
The concrete steps of jet-plating metallization overcoat: have the metal base of copper film to insert another vacuum chamber sputter, feed argon gas and maintain 1~3 * 10 -3Torr starts sputter gold target material or nickel gold target material this moment, and the current density of control sputtered target material is at 0.1~1W/cm 2, plated with gold film or nickel gold thin film, about 0.1~1 μ m of the THICKNESS CONTROL of golden film or nickel gold thin film.
6, etch-resisting film is with the mode of printing or the conductor part of the mode screened circuit figure of exposure imaging, and the non-conductor part is removed in etching, sloughs etch-resisting film again; Wherein, etch recipe is: phosphoric acid 500ml/L, glacial acetic acid 400ml/L, nitric acid 100ml/L, and etch temperature is a room temperature, etching period is 60-120s.
7, printing liquid photosensitive welding resistant printing ink, it is roasting in advance to put into baking oven, and roasting in advance temperature is controlled at 75 ℃, and the roasting in advance time is controlled at 30min, and by ultraviolet light polymerization, the parameter of ultraviolet light polymerization is 800mj/cm then 2, 3m/s, the time of ultraviolet light polymerization is 120s.
